    It is a little bit silly since having an army of 3000 units doesn't actually make the adventure any easier than having an army of 2000 units. You're still gonna need to chain up a few days worth of troops in the barracks to replace lost ones.

    And that's even if you're doing it as a three player adventure.

    So, while not really a blunder, it's just a pointless and useless target and shows, once again, that BB aren't really in touch with how this game is actually played or how many losses people are going to have playing these new adventures.

    The Vailiant Little Tailor is on the combat simulator and there are guides already, so I'm not sure what you mean about 'having' to do it blind. There are not a lot of guides at the moment, but the first thing people asked about fairytale adventures was 'is there a guide?' and then seemed a bit put out that the number of guides isn't that great so far. The guides have been created by some very committed players who have worked hard on test to find strategies for completing The Valiant Little Tailor and they should be congratulated for coming up with something in such a short period of time. The other option that is always available is to sit with a combat simulator and run your own figures through it - if you don't want to risk that on live servers it is still possible on test and then you can play your own strategy once you've tested it there.
